Davrian

Davrian was a British car manufacturer, founded in 1965 by Adrian Evans and based in Wales. The company was known for producing lightweight, fibreglass-bodied sports cars, often powered by Hillman Imp engines.

Davrian's early models, such as the Mk1, Mk2, and Mk3, were typically sold in kit form, allowing enthusiasts to assemble the cars themselves. This made them relatively affordable and popular among amateur racers and club motorsport participants. The cars were designed with a focus on handling and performance rather than comfort or luxury.

Later models included the Davrian Dragon, which was a more sophisticated design and offered in both kit and fully built forms. Davrian production continued, with periods of inactivity, until the early 1980s. The Davrian marque has a devoted following among classic car enthusiasts, and restored or original examples occasionally appear at classic car shows and motorsport events. The design principles of lightweight construction and performance-oriented engineering remain hallmarks of the brand.
